Movie Overview: Everything Will Be All Right
| Movie | Everything Will Be All Right |
| Release Year | 1995 |
| Director | Dmitriy Astrakhan |
| Genre | Drama / Romance / Comedy |
| Runtime | 100 minutes |
| Language | RU |
